Quote:
Quote:
This is for all of you that say a Mopar cant work with slapper bars.
Well, they work on every leaf sprung nova Ive ever seen. Why not a Dodge? The bar just look bad(ugly)IMO. Im just one of those kinda guys. What happens when u take them off?
I have always heard that they cant work cuz of the Mopars having short front spring segments in comparison to a Ford or GM .My Dart had nothing for traction devices when i got it and got 1.65- 1.68 60 foots most of the time plus would spin the slicks easily as the rearend would sqaut .It also bent the shocks from the rearend rolling up off the hit of the throttle .Once i got the Slapper Bars figured out my 60's went to mid to high 1.5 60 foots everytime and no wheel spin or spring wrap ,plus it lifts the front and back of the car on the hit of the throttle with them.Would Caltracs or S/S springs work on my car ? Sure they would .Would it be as cheap ? Not by a long shot .I had a few people in the pits walk by my Dodge in the pits and say "are those slapper bars on a Mopar "???
